Struts2报Error filterStart错误通常是由于部署问题引起的,可能是缺少依赖项或配置错误。以下是一些可能的解决方法:
检查依赖项:确保项目中的所有依赖项都已正确添加到项目的构建路径中。特别是检查是否缺少任何必需的Struts2库。
检查web.xml配置:检查web.xml文件是否正确配置了Struts2过滤器。确保过滤器的名称、类和顺序正确。
检查web服务器配置:如果使用的是Tomcat等web服务器,确保服务器的配置文件中正确包含了Struts2的相关配置。比如,在Tomcat的web.xml中需要添加Struts2的过滤器配置。
检查日志:查看应用程序的日志文件,查找更详细的错误消息,以便更好地理解问题的原因。
更新Struts2版本:尝试更新Struts2的版本,以解决可能的bug或问题。
检查项目结构:确保项目的文件和目录结构正确,特别是确保Struts2配置文件(如struts.xml)位于正确的位置。
如果以上方法还无法解决问题,可以尝试搜索特定的错误消息或向Struts2社区提问,以获取更详细和针对性的解决方案。